WebTo soak the hulled barley, place 1 cup dry barley grains in a large bowl and add 3 cups of water. Set aside to soak for a few hours or up to overnight. Boil 3 cups of water or broth and add 1 cup of barley. Season with a big dash of kosher salt. …

Web2. Cooking Basic Barley. Rinse and Soak: Begin by rinsing the barley under cold water to remove any dust or debris. Soaking hulled barley overnight can reduce cooking time and make it more digestible, although this step can be skipped if time is short. Cook: Use about 3 cups of water for every cup of barley.
